Transaction 073aedd8bd060224969e581c6ee4fed419bfc802f817e2e9186b79d482826455
1 Input
1 Output
-
073aedd8bd060224969e581c6ee4fed419bfc802f817e2e9186b79d482826455:0
- value
- 102174190
- script pubkey
- OP_0 OP_PUSHBYTES_20 8152731c7f06e160c92a9c7785b2d7ea8528328f
- address
- bc1qs9f8x8rlqmskpjf2n3mctvkha2zjsv50sh5wtm